git解决冲突的正确步骤
时间: 2023-11-01 15:07:43 浏览: 44
当在Git中遇到冲突时,可以按照以下步骤解决冲突:
1. 首先,使用`git status`命令检查当前仓库的状态,确认存在冲突。
2. 打开有冲突的文件,可以看到冲突部分被特殊标记标识(<<<<<<<,=======,>>>>>>>)。编辑文件,解决冲突。根据需要保留某个分支的修改或者进行合并修改。
3. 解决冲突后,保存文件。
4. 使用`git add <file>`命令将解决冲突的文件标记为已解决。
5. 如果存在多个有冲突的文件,重复步骤2至步骤4,解决所有冲突。
6. 当所有冲突都解决并且已经将所有解决的文件标记为已解决后,使用`git status`再次检查仓库状态,确保所有冲突已解决。
7. 使用`git commit`命令提交解决冲突的更改。可以添加适当的提交消息来描述解决的内容。
8. 最后,使用`git push`命令将提交的更改推送到远程仓库。
这样就完成了解决冲突的过程。希望对你有所帮助!如有更多问题,请继续提问。
相关问题
git解决merge冲突
当多个人在同一个Git仓库中修改同一个文件时,可能会发生冲突,需要进行合并操作。如果Git无法自动合并,则会提示冲突。下面是一些解决冲突的步骤:
1. 在命令行中使用`git status`命令查看哪些文件发生了冲突。
2. 手动编辑冲突文件,解决冲突。可以使用文本编辑器打开发生冲突的文件,查看冲突部分,然后进行编辑。
3. 在解决冲突后,使用`git add`命令将修改后的文件添加到暂存区。
4. 使用`git commit`命令提交修改。
5. 如果修改后的文件仍然有冲突,则需要重复上述步骤,直到没有冲突为止。
需要注意的是,合并冲突时需要仔细检查每个修改,确保修改正确无误。同时,为了避免冲突,建议多个人在修改同一个文件时,先在本地创建一个分支,然后在分支上进行修改和提交,最后再将分支合并到主分支上。
git excel解决冲突
要解决Git中的冲突,可以使用以下步骤来解决:
1. 首先,使用`git status`命令检查当前分支的状态,确认是否存在冲突的文件。
2. 打开包含冲突的文件,可以看到Git已经在冲突的部分添加了特定的标记。在冲突的部分,将包含冲突的代码修改为所需的内容。例如,可以手动选择保留HEAD分支的修改或者另一个分支的修改,或者合并两者的内容。确保解决冲突后的代码是正确的。
3. 解决冲突后,使用`git add`命令将已解决的文件标记为已解决冲突。
4. 最后,使用`git commit`命令提交已解决冲突的文件。在提交消息中,可以简要描述解决冲突的方式或原因。